Combating the Liverpool Mosquito Infestation: A Guide for Homeowners

Liverpool's warm, humid summers can create the favorable conditions for mosquitoes to thrive. These pesky insects can quickly become a nuisance, attacking homeowners and disrupting their enjoyment of the outdoors. However, with some proactive measures, you can effectively control the mosquito population around your property.

Start by identifying potential mosquito breeding grounds on your property. Standing water in buckets, clogged gutters, and even small puddles can provide ideal breeding sites for mosquitoes. frequently inspect these areas and eliminate any standing water.

To further repell mosquitoes, consider using environmentally friendly repellents around your property. Planting mosquito-repelling plants, such as lavender or citronella, can also help create a less inviting environment for these insects.

When spending time outdoors, utilize long sleeves and pants to minimize exposed skin. And remember to always apply mosquito repellent to any exposed areas.

By following these simple steps, you can significantly reduce the mosquito population around your home and enjoy a more peaceful outdoor experience in Liverpool.
